Regarding a fill dr, I am using Fill Center USA. They have one in Farmington,Mo about 1.5 hrs south of St.Louis. If you go to their website I think they are going to open one in Little Rock. Fillcentersusa.com Their initial visit is 299.00 and fills are 155.00 but does not include fluroscopy and I think that is an additional 75-100.Any more questions let me know. Dactyl

I went to Dr.Lopez Corvala surgery went excellent I also was a self pay patient and it was 7500.00. But the only down fall is tryen to find a doctor in your immediate area that will do the fills behind one of the mexican doctors.I live in saint louis and I travel all the way to chicago to get my fills. That's the closest dr. that will do the fills behind a mexican dr.

It was cheaper for me to go to TJ so I picked Bajanor clinic and not including airfare it was $6,800 (I have a mid-band and love it) I was picked up by Dr. Carlos and he definetly did not expect a tip for the ride from and to the airport in San Diego. The first night I stayed in the Clinic/Hospital so no cost. The second night at beautiful Hotel Lucerna (or something like that) but the room was included in my total package. I had to tip the guy who took my bag to my room ($3 is good on average), then each time I ordered room service a tip was needed ($3 or so), my room had a coffee pot in it and 2 bottled waters complimentary which I used to make my own hot tea at night since I brought tea bags with me (soothing after surgery.) I'd also bought a couple of bottles of Water when I got to the airport in San Diego and put them in my bag so I had them on hand too. I think I spent about $30 on Soup, Jello, beverages at the hotel. I didn't feel up to going shopping or out to do anything. I just watched TV (about 7 channels of English), slept, read, and all round took it easy.
